Joao Palhinha was a popular man over summer, with Bayern Munich notably coming close to sealing his services in what would have been a huge blow to Fulham.
The Cottagers have struggled to gain any kind of form this term, though, and as such will be keen to hang onto their prized asset - particularly having lost Aleksandar Mitrovic over the summer.
Marco Silva has already claimed that there has been 'no approach' despite a host of Premier League sides monitoring the Portugal star's situation - could that be a saga to develop over the next month?

Speculation had been mounting that Carlo Ancelotti was set to join up with the Brazil national side after his contract with Real Madrid ran out.
Ednaldo Rodrigues, president of the Brazilian FA (CBF) had told Reuters that the Italian manger was his primary target for the national team.
Yet, Real Madrid have announced that Ancelotti will now extend his contract until 2026.

For any Newcastle fans hoping to see their injury-ravaged squad replenished next month, maybe look away now.
Eddie Howe has revealed that there has been no assurances of funds in the transfer window, with the Magpies restricted by Financial Fair Pla regulations.

We heard earler about Lloris' potential move to LAFC, bringing about an end to an 11-year stay at Tottenham, but reports are suggesting that one is close to completion.
Fabrizio Romano now reports that Tottenham gave the MLS side the green light, with Postecoglou hinting a development could come 'in the next couple of days'.

Fabio Silva has not exactly had the desired impact at Wolves since joining for £35m from Porto three years ago.
As such the Portuguese youngster - who had been tipped for a very bright future indeed - is now off on another loan, in the hope that more minutes might brng the besst out of him.

Mail Sport also reported exclusively that Hugo Lloris is in talks with MLS side LAFC over a January move.
The World Cup winner with France has been on the periphery at Tottenham after losing his spot and captaincy, and it looks like he could be bringing an end to his 11-year stint in north London next month.
